发布时间2025-06-18 09:13
在当今这个科技飞速发展的时代,人工智能(AI)技术已经深入到我们生活的方方面面。其中,AI语音SDK作为一项重要的技术,可以实现语音识别、语音合成等功能,极大地提高了人机交互的效率。那么,如何使用AI语音SDK实现语音识别与语音识别的实时更新呢?本文将为您详细解析。
一、了解AI语音SDK
AI语音SDK(语音识别软件开发包)是一种基于人工智能技术的语音识别工具,它可以将人类的语音信号转换为文本信息。通过使用AI语音SDK,开发者可以轻松地将语音识别功能集成到自己的应用程序中,为用户提供便捷的语音交互体验。
二、语音识别的实现
采集语音信号:首先,需要通过麦克风或其他语音采集设备采集用户的语音信号。
预处理:对采集到的语音信号进行预处理,包括降噪、去除静音等,以提高语音识别的准确性。
特征提取:将预处理后的语音信号转换为特征向量,如梅尔频率倒谱系数(MFCC)等。
模型训练:使用大量的语音数据对模型进行训练,使其能够识别不同的语音特征。
识别:将特征向量输入到训练好的模型中,模型会输出对应的文本信息。
三、语音识别的实时更新
数据采集:实时采集用户的语音信号,并将其传输到服务器。
预处理与特征提取:对采集到的语音信号进行预处理和特征提取,与语音识别过程相同。
模型预测:将特征向量输入到模型中,实时输出预测结果。
结果反馈:将预测结果反馈给用户,实现语音识别的实时更新。
四、AI语音SDK的优势
高精度:AI语音SDK采用先进的深度学习技术,识别精度高,能够准确识别各种口音和方言。
易用性:AI语音SDK提供了丰富的API接口,方便开发者快速集成到自己的应用程序中。
稳定性:AI语音SDK经过大量数据训练,具有很高的稳定性,能够适应各种场景。
可扩展性:AI语音SDK支持多种语言和方言,可根据需求进行扩展。
五、总结
使用AI语音SDK实现语音识别与语音识别的实时更新,是当前人工智能技术的一个重要应用。通过了解AI语音SDK的原理和优势,开发者可以轻松地将语音识别功能集成到自己的应用程序中,为用户提供便捷的语音交互体验。在未来,随着AI技术的不断发展,语音识别技术将更加成熟,为我们的生活带来更多便利。
猜你喜欢:AI对话开发
更多热门资讯